Hailing from Dallas, Texas, the talented Juliana Madrid is making waves with the release of her fourth track, Trackstar, from her highly anticipated sophomore Afterlife EP, set to be released on Neon Gold Records. At just 22 years old, this singer-songwriter showcases her exceptional skills with her breezy and captivating vocals. The track is a pure gold gem of alternative pop, featuring mesmerizing melodies and excellent guitar work. As the song progresses, it builds up to a climactic moment around the 2nd minute mark that is nothing short of anthemic, leaving listeners enthralled.

Juliana Madrid’s musical prowess is undeniably impressive, and Trackstar is a testament to her talent and promise as an artist.

Jules elaborates: “The “Trackstar” is just me making a reference to basically every -peaks-in-high school- award winning- jock type -cliche. In the song I talk about having a relationship with someone who really identifies with those traits, and sort of the “lesson well learned” after its end. It was a realization that this so-called “Trackstar” was trying to escape his empty life and relive the glory days through this newfound love. Just one of those tropes that seems to never go out of style unfortunately.”
